gitty/gitty 深入解析Token.i
2025-12-05
在区块链网络中,特别是以太坊等智能合约平台,Gas是指执行交易或合约操作所需的计算资源费用。每当用户发起交易或调用智能合约时,系统会根据所需资源的数量收取相应的Gas费用。Gas的计量单位为Gwei,1 Gwei等于10^-9 ETH。
Gas的设计旨在防止网络过载和恶意行为,如果没有Gas的机制,用户可以通过无限制的请求占用网络资源。而Gas的存在让用户在进行交易时必须考虑到费用,从而为网络的安全性和可持续性提供了保障。
### Token.im的Gas计算原理Token.im作为一个去中心化的数字资产管理钱包,提供了快速、安全的交易体验。在进行交易时,用户需要对此次交易的Gas费用有一个清晰的理解。Token.im使用的Gas费用计算主要基于以下几个因素:
1. **操作类型:** 不同的操作(比如转账、调用合约等)所需的计算资源是不同的。例如,转账操作所需的Gas会少于执行复杂的合约操作。 2. **网络拥堵:** Gas费用还与网络的当前状态有关。在网络拥堵时,为了能够优先处理交易,用户可能需要支付更高的Gas费用。 3. **Gas价格:** 每笔交易的Gas价格由用户自行设置,通常会根据当前网络情况及个人需求进行调整。用户可选择较低的Gas价格来节省费用,但这可能导致交易确认延迟。 4. **Gas限制:** 每笔交易都有一个最大Gas限制,这是用户在发起交易时设定的上限,如果交易消耗的Gas超过这个限制,交易将会失败,这也是保护用户资金的一种机制。 ### 影响Gas费的因素我们进一步分析会发现,影响Gas费用的因素还有很多,包括:
- **智能合约复杂性:** 智能合约越复杂,执行所需的计算越多,Gas费用就越高。 - **用户的设置:** 用户可以根据个人需求在Gas价格和Gas限制之间做出选择。设置较高的Gas价可以加快交易的确认速度,但同时也会增加成本。 - **市场活动:** 在市场波动较大的时候,由于大量用户同时进行交易,网络的负载会增加,从而导致Gas价格上涨。 ### Gas计算实例举一个具体的例子来帮助理解Gas计算机制。假设你在Token.im上进行一次ETH转账,交易的Gas限制设定为21000,而当前的Gas价格为100 Gwei。那么,计算公式为:
交易费用 = Gas限制 x Gas价格
在这个例子中:
交易费用 = 21000 x 100 Gwei = 2100000 Gwei
转换为ETH则为:2100000 Gwei = 0.0021 ETH(因为1 ETH = 10^9 Gwei)
用户在进行交易前,可以通过类似的计算,了解本次交易的预计费用,从而做出合理的决策。
### Token.im的Gas管理工具Token.im提供了一些工具和选项,帮助用户Gas费用。例如:
- **自动Gas预测:** 在用户发起交易时,Token.im可以根据当前网络状态和交易类型来自动预测合适的Gas价格,用户也可以根据自身需求进行调整。 - **历史Gas费用记录:** 用户可以查看历史交易的Gas费用情况,帮助其更好地理解Gas价格的波动,并作出相应的操作调整。 - **交易排队机制:** Token.im允许用户设置优先级,用户可以选择在网络拥堵时将交易推迟到回落时,节省Gas费用。 ### 相关问题探讨 在讨论Token.im的Gas计算机制后,以下是三个可能的相关 1. **Gas费用是否会一直上涨?** 2. **对于新用户,如何有效管理Gas费用?** 3. **Gas计算对智能合约开发者的影响是什么?** ### Gas费用是否会一直上涨?Gas费用的变化受多种因素影响,包括网络的使用情况、应用的普及率以及以太坊的技术升级。这些因素共同作用,导致Gas费用呈现出波动的状态。
随着越来越多的DApps和智能合约上线,网络的使用频率逐渐增高。特别是在牛市时,大量用户涌入,导致网络拥堵,Gas费用自然水涨船高。然而在市场平稳或下行时,Gas费用也可能下降。
以太坊正在进行Version 2.0的升级,目标是提高网络的处理能力和效率,这是降低Gas费用的一种潜在方式。此外,Layer 2解决方案的出现也使得部分交易可以在链下进行,从而降低了其实交易成本。
市场供需关系直接影响Gas费用。当需求增加、供应不足时,Gas费用会上涨。反之,当需求减小、供应过剩时,Gas费用有可能回落。因此,预测未来Gas费用的变化应综合考虑市场动态。
### 对于新用户,如何有效管理Gas费用?
对于刚接触区块链的新用户来说,如何有效管理自己的Gas费用,确保交易的高效与成本的低廉,是一门重要的学问。
新用户首先应该了解Gas的基本知识,包括Gas价格、Gas限制等,可以通过学习相关文档和社区讨论来加深理解。这将帮助用户在进行交易时作出更明智的决策。
Token.im等钱包提供了自动Gas预测、历史费用记录等功能,新用户可以利用这些工具,进行合理的费用设置。在进行交易前,可以查看当前网络状态及推荐Gas价格,设置合理的Gas费用,避免因设置偏低而导致交易失败。
网络的拥堵状态对Gas费用有着至关重要的影响,新用户在进行交易时,可以选择在网络相对 less busy的时段进行交易,以降低手续费。通常,周末和节假日期间,交易的压力会相对减少,可以考虑在这些时间段进行交易。
### Gas计算对智能合约开发者的影响是什么?对智能合约开发者而言,Gas的计算是设计合约的重要一环,良好的Gas管理会影响合约的使用体验和市场竞争力。
开发者在设计智能合约时需要考虑执行的效率,尤其是在计算复杂度较高的操作中。代码,减少不必要的内存消耗和计算,可以降低Gas费用。在合约发布后,开发者还可以监控合约的实际使用情况,反馈数据经常调整合约,提升用户体验。
对于用户而言,过高的Gas费用会影响他们的使用体验,因此,Gas计算的合理性直接决定了合约的吸引力和市场占有率。开发者要密切关注Gas价格变化,以便及时调整自己合约的操作方式,从而降低用户的使用成本。
在Gas计算的过程中,开发者需要确保合约合规,并具备安全性。在设计合约时,合理设置Gas限制能够避免某些攻击行为,例如重入攻击。同时,合约的效率以减少用户的Gas成本也是市场竞争中需要考虑的因素。
### 结语 通过以上各个方面的探讨,我们了解到Token.im的Gas计算机制及其在区块链交易中的关键作用。Gas不仅关乎交易的成本,更是一种有效管理区块链网络资源的重要手段。在不断演变的区块链生态中,用户和开发者需共同关注Gas费用的管理与,从而推动整个行业的健康发展。